flashman8 wrote:because HMG don't have a clue about what our forces really need...................... :facepalm:

they should have kept the Harrier instead of `giving` them away to the USA so we could buy the F35........... :mad:

remember when TSR2 was in development but that was scrapped so we could buy the F1-11 from uncle Sam, only for that deal to fall through after the jigs were destroyed for the TSR2 and it was too late.......................... :clown: :dizzy: :wall:


Far from a given though that the TSR2 programme would've been restarted on the back of the F-111 delays/cancellation even if tooling was still available. The F-111K was cancelled due to its rising costs and sterling vanishing down a hole, yet the projected purchase/operating costs of TSR2 would've been higher still.
